直播伴侣如何获取rtmp服务器

fiy 其他 121

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    获取rtmp服务器的方法有多种,下面将介绍几种常用的途径。

    1. 自建服务器:可以自行搭建一个rtmp服务器,这种方式需要具备一定的技术能力,需要了解服务器运维和网络知识。搭建服务器需要有一台云服务器或物理服务器,并且需要安装相应的rtmp服务器软件,如Nginx、Wowza、Adobe Media Server等。搭建完成后,你可以获取服务器的IP地址或域名,以及rtmp推流和播放的端口,这些信息将用于配置直播软件。

    2. 使用第三方rtmp服务提供商:有一些第三方服务提供商专门提供rtmp服务器服务,你可以租用它们提供的rtmp服务器。通过这种方式,你不需要自己搭建服务器,可以节省时间和精力。常见的第三方服务提供商有Tencent Cloud、UCloud、Aliyun等,你可以根据自己的需求选择合适的服务商。

    3. 使用云直播平台:一些云直播平台提供了rtmp服务器的服务,你可以通过注册账号并在平台上创建直播频道来获取rtmp服务器信息。这种方式适合不擅长技术操作的用户,只需按照平台的指引进行操作即可。

    以上是获取rtmp服务器的几种常用方法,根据自身的情况选择合适的方式,以便顺利进行直播。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要获取一个RTMP服务器来作为直播伴侣,有几种途径可以选择:

    1. 自建服务器:你可以选择自己搭建一个RTMP服务器,使用一些开源的软件,如Nginx、FFmpeg等。这需要一定的技术知识和经验,需要了解服务器设置和配置以及网络安全等方面的知识。自建服务器的好处是自主性高,可以对服务器进行自由定制,但需要付出一定的时间和精力。

    2. 云服务提供商:现在有很多云服务提供商可以提供RTMP服务器的托管服务。通过这些云服务提供商,你可以租用只需简单设置就能使用的RTMP服务器。例如,亚马逊云计算(Amazon Web Services,AWS)提供了一项名为MediaLive的服务,它可以为直播提供RTMP服务器。其他一些云服务提供商如腾讯云、阿里云、微软Azure也提供了类似的托管服务。

    3. 第三方流媒体服务:还有一些专门提供流媒体服务的第三方公司或平台,如Twitch、YouTube Live、Facebook Live等。这些平台都提供了RTMP服务器,你可以直接使用他们的服务器来搭建你的直播伴侣。这些平台一般提供了简单易用的接口和工具,方便你直接开始直播。

    4. 社区和论坛:在流媒体和直播领域,有一些活跃的社区和论坛可以提供帮助和支持。你可以在这些社区中咨询其他用户和专家,寻找他们的建议和经验。有时候,一些用户可能会分享他们自己搭建的RTMP服务器,你可以参考他们的方法,学习如何获取一个RTMP服务器。

    5. 租用专门的流媒体服务器:还有一些公司专门提供流媒体服务器租用服务,他们会提供RTMP服务器以及其他相关的服务和支持。租用流媒体服务器可以省去自己搭建服务器的麻烦,专注于直播内容的制作和推广。你可以通过搜索引擎找到这些公司并与他们联系,了解他们的服务和费用。

    无论选择哪种方式获取RTMP服务器,都需要考虑以下几个因素:可用性、可扩展性、安全性、价格等。同时,也要注意确保服务器的良好运行和稳定性,以提供流畅的直播体验。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    获取RTMP服务器主要有两种方式:购买或搭建。

    一、购买RTMP服务器:

    1. 在互联网上搜索RTMP服务器提供商,比如腾讯云、阿里云等;
    2. 进入相应的网站,注册并登录账号;
    3. 选择并购买合适的RTMP服务器套餐;
    4. 在购买完成后,提供商会提供一个RTMP服务器的地址和相应的密钥等信息,可以通过这些信息来连接服务器。

    二、搭建RTMP服务器:
    下面以Nginx服务器为例,介绍如何搭建RTMP服务器:

    1. 安装Nginx:
      a. 在Linux系统中,可以通过包管理器(如apt、yum)直接安装Nginx;
      b. 在Windows系统中,可以在Nginx官网下载对应的安装程序,然后按照提示进行安装。

    2. 配置Nginx:
      a. 打开Nginx的配置文件,一般为nginx.conf(在Linux系统中位于/etc/nginx/下,Windows系统中位于Nginx安装目录下的conf文件夹内);
      b. 配置Nginx的RTMP模块,找到http段(http { … })后添加以下内容:

      rtmp {
        server {
          listen 1935; # RTMP服务器监听的端口号
          application live {
            live on; # 开启直播模块
            record off; # 禁止录制
          }
        }
      }
      
    3. 启动Nginx:
      a. 在Linux系统中,运行sudo service nginx start命令启动Nginx;
      b. 在Windows系统中,可以通过Nginx的安装目录下的start.bat文件启动Nginx。

    4. 客户端连接:
      a. 在直播软件中,设置连接服务器的参数,包括RTMP服务器地址和推流密钥等;
      b. 通过设置的参数,连接到搭建好的RTMP服务器。

    通过购买或搭建RTMP服务器,可以方便地实现直播功能,并且可以根据需要扩展和定制化服务。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部